Unraveling the Enigma: How Does Bitcoin Mining Work?

Wiki Article

Bitcoin mining is a intricate process that underpins the very structure of the Bitcoin network. It involves powerful computers decoding complex mathematical challenges. These calculations validate Bitcoin transactions and add them into the blockchain, a distributed copyright that records all Bitcoin transactions. Miners who successfully solve these puzzles are granted with newly generated Bitcoins and transaction fees. This process ensures the integrity of the Bitcoin network and avoids fraud or alteration.

Bitcoin Mining: From Hardware to Hashrate

Bitcoin extraction is a complex process that requires specialized hardware and a deep understanding of cryptography. The primary component of this sector is the miner, which utilizes immense computing power to decipher complex mathematical puzzles. Each successful answer results in the formation of new Bitcoin and a incentive for the miner. This system is measured by the miner's computing efficiency, which represents the number of hashes it can execute per second. A higher hash rate suggests a greater chance of finding a solution and therefore earning more rewards.
